The Dalai Lama rarely speaks directly on the topics of leadership, business and economics. Through in-depth dialogue with a number of leading social and economic thinkers, this important book sheds light on the most pressing questions that we face. It has the power to change your way of thinking.

Foreword by H.H. the Dalai Lama. Foreword by Anders Ferguson. Introduction. Part 1: Compassion or competition. 1. The Buddha and the banker. 2. First dialogue: Compassion or Competition (Amsterdam, 1999). Part 2: Designing an economy that works for everyone. 3. On the path of purpose. 4. Second dialogue: Designing an Economy that Works for Everyone (Irvine, California, 2004). Part 3: Leadership for a sustainable world. 5. Shared purpose in business. 6. Third dialogue: Leadership for a Sustainable World (The Hague, 2009). Part 4: Education of the heart. 7. Living shared purpose: the "how" of change. 8. Fourth dialogue: Education of the Heart (Rotterdam, 2014). 9. Shared purpose: the case for societal leadership in business. 10. Six questions to develop shared purpose. Concluding remarks. Afterword by David Cooperrider.
